He’s not sure he’s ever been real. She’s not sure she’ll ever be whole again.
Beckett Davis has been many things: reliable, likeable, on track to be the most accurate kicker in professional football history, and multiple-time winner of made up awards like pro-athlete with the most beautiful smile.
He’s also spent a lifetime shouldering responsibilities that didn’t belong to him, but he doesn’t like to think about that. Until a missed kick makes him one of the most hated people in the city and lands him doing damage control as a volunteer in his least favourite place: a hospital.
But it’s where he meets her.
Greer Roberts deals in logic and absolutes. She spends her days performing surgery and staying behind carefully constructed boundaries that keep what’s left of her safe, even though she’s not sure how either of those things make her feel anymore. There is one thing she’s absolutely certain of, though: she doesn’t date. So it doesn’t matter that a downtrodden Beckett Davis ends up in the same elevator as her and in a moment of weakness, she invites him to volunteer with her patients.
She might see right through him, and he might understand her in a way that no one else ever has, but they’re just business acquaintances.
Until they’re not. And nothing scares her more than that.
